Finland Reaches Historic European Championship Basketball Semifinal

Finland is clear for its very first semifinal in a European Championship basketball. This after quarterfinal victory over Georgia with 93–79. This is probably the best team in Finnish basketball history. The guys are incredible, you have to be proud, says Sasu Salin to Yle.

Finland led with 17 points at halftime (57–40), but Georgia came back in the third period. And with just over five minutes left of the match, the lead was down to seven points.

Then Elias Valtonen struck with two three-pointers and the lead was up to 13 points.

It became too difficult for Georgia to catch up.

The Finnish victory was decided mainly by the team's three-point shooting, they made 17 three-pointers.

A fairly typical performance by us – we go up in the lead, then it gets exciting and in the end we solve it, says superstar Lauri Markkanen to Yle.

Finland has never played a semifinal in a European Championship before and it was only the second time that they played a quarterfinal (most recently 2022). In the semifinal on Friday, Germany or Slovenia are waiting, who play their quarterfinal tonight.

Finland was responsible for a major upset in the round of 16 when they eliminated last year's Olympic Games third-place and World Championship runner-up – Serbia.

Finland is one of four European Championship hosts along with Latvia, Poland, and Cyprus. The finals will be decided in Riga, Latvia.
